Chiefs Players Signed a Petition to Ban Taylor Swift? – Snopes.com

About this rating
On June 5, 2024, a Facebook page named America’s Last Line of Defense posted a meme positing that nearly all of the Kansas City Chiefs football team signed a petition banning Taylor Swift from their home games next season:
Almost Every Chiefs Player Signed a Petition to Ban Taylor Swift from Home Games Next Season: “She’s Just a Distraction”
The Kansas City Chiefs players have had enough of being second in line to Taylor Swift at their own stadium.
“It’s like we’re not even there half the time. She’s not doing anything to help the team.”
Hopefully, the management will listen. Travis Kelce didn’t sign. Patrick Mahomes did.
As of this writing, the post has amassed more than 10,000 reactions and 3,300 comments. Commenters had a mixed reception to the post, with some questioning whether it was true. One wrote, “I wish they would sign a petition to send her to Siberia,” while another added, “Can’t she just enjoy the game??”
However, this post was not a factual recounting of real-life events. America’s Last Line of Defense describes its output as being humorous or satirical in nature, as follows:
Everything on this website is fiction. If you believe that it is real, you should have your head examined. Any similarities between this site’s pure fantasy and actual people, places, and events are purely coincidental and all images should be considered altered and satirical.
The Facebook page’s introduction reads: “The flagship of the ALLOD network of trollery. Nothing on this page is real.” 
We’ve fact-checked other posts from America’s Last Line of Defense regarding Swift and the Chiefs, including the claim that kicker Harrison Butker was named the team’s captain and the rumor that the singer canceled her tour dates in what she called “racist Florida.”
